Joan of Arc of Mongolia (1989) - A group of cosmopolitan women passengers aboard the Trans-Siberian/Mongolian Railway are taken prisoner by Ulan Iga, a warrior princess.
This had a promising start introducing all the quirky characters on the train, but it really slowed down once the female passengers were taken prisoner with much of the rest of the movie focusing on the routine rituals of the Mongolians. While more polished, I was expecting another off the wall-wacky outing from director Ulrike Ottinger like her earlier film, Madame X: An Absolute Ruler. So ultimately, a little disappointing. 5/10
